## Environments — Gaugewick Sidecar

Gaugewick is the metrics-aggregation sidecar attached to every service pod. Three environments: dev (noisy, short retention), staging (mirrors prod sampling), prod (strict quotas). Never point a dev sidecar at the prod collector; quota alarms fire instantly. Contractors get staging access only. The staging sidecar runs with the configuration below.

service settings:
[druvan]
port = 3306
region = central-4
host = druvan.braskdata.local
team = kelax
timeout_ms = 1000
retries = 2

Quarterly Planning Note — Eastvale Expansion

Marrowfield Goods will open two sites in the Eastvale region next quarter. Property secured; fit-out begins week two. Hiring targets: 18 staff per site. Department heads must submit resource plans by the 15th. Marketing launch aligns with the regional trade fair. Budget allocations are final. Strategic detail follows in the confidential note below.

management briefing: Project Ulavan slips by two quarters because of the staffing delay.

## Escalation: Mistral-gate circuit breaker (upstream Ledgerly API)

If the breaker for the Ledgerly upstream stays open past three consecutive half-open probes, do not force-close it manually; this has previously caused retry storms. Instead, confirm upstream health via the Ledgerly status dashboard, capture the breaker state snapshot, and page the Integrations on-call. For review questions about threshold tuning, contact the owning team at the address below.

alerts address for bagaf-fajog: oliwyn@norvasys.internal